Temper
ˈtɛmpə
Temper definitions
noun
temper
- a person's state of mind seen in terms of their being angry or calm
"he rushed out in a very bad temper"
temperament disposition nature character personality make-up constitution mind spirit stamp mettle mould- a tendency to become angry easily
"I know my temper gets the better of me at times"
- an angry state of mind
"Drew had walked out in a temper"
- the degree of hardness and elasticity in steel or other metal
"the blade rapidly heats up and the metal loses its temper"
verb
temper
tempered
tempering
tempers
- improve the hardness and elasticity of (steel or other metal) by reheating and then cooling it
"the way a smith would temper a sword"
- improve the consistency or resiliency of (a substance) by means of a process involving heat or chemicals
"the display is a single sheet of glass, tempered for strength"
- act as a neutralizing or counterbalancing force to (something)
"their idealism is tempered with realism"
- tune (a piano or other instrument) so as to adjust the note intervals correctly
